基于差分进化的模糊PID复合控制在汽轮机转速调节系统中的应用

摘    要:为了改善汽轮机调速系统的动态响应特性以及稳定性,采用模糊PID复合控制,首先建立对象的数学模型,并通过差分进化算法对控制器参数离线寻优,最后基于Matlab平台对方法进行了验证.仿真结果表明:该方法在处理负载突变情况时,相比传统的PID控制器有更好的响应,稳定时间和超调率均有较大改进;当模型参数发生改变时,模糊PID复...

Fuzzy-PID control using a differential evolution for steam turbine speed governing system

Abstract:To satisfy the higher control performance requirement of the steam turbine speed governing system,a fuzzy PID(proportional integral derivative) controller is presented.Firstly the mathematical model of this object is built,and then a differential evolution is used to tune the controller parameters,finally this controller are simulated on Matlab.The results show that the method has many merits including small overshoot,good robustness and fast response compared with the conventional PID controller.So the con...
